Arusha to Tarangire National Park

Arusha to Tarangire National Park

After breakfast at your hotel in Arusha, your driver-guide will pick you up for the journey to Tarangire National Park, approximately 4–5 hours’ drive. Upon arrival, embark on an afternoon game drive in this wildlife-rich park, famous for its huge elephant herds, ancient baobab trees, and diverse wildlife. Spot lions, giraffes, zebras, wildebeest, and other animals in their natural habitat while capturing stunning photos of the savannah landscape. After the safari, drive to your lodge in Mto wa Mbu for dinner and overnight stay, ready for the next day’s adventure in the Northern Tanzania circuit.

Main Destination:
Tarangire National Park
Best Time To Visit July to November (Animals come to the Tarangire River)
High Season June to October (The park is full of visitors)
Best Weather June to October (Little rainfall)

Lake Manyara National Park

Lake Manyara National Park

After breakfast at your lodge in Mto wa Mbu, depart for Lake Manyara National Park for a morning game drive. Explore its diverse landscapes, from lush woodlands to the lake shores, and spot wildlife including tree-climbing lions, elephants, baboons, giraffes, and flamingos (seasonal). Enjoy stunning scenery and photography opportunities throughout the park. After the game drive, return to your lodge in Mto wa Mbu for lunch, relaxation, and dinner, spending a comfortable overnight stay in preparation for the Serengeti adventure the next day.

Mto wa Mbu to Central Serengeti National Park

Mto wa Mbu to Central Serengeti National Park

After an early breakfast at your lodge in Mto wa Mbu, depart for the world-famous Central Serengeti National Park. Enjoy a scenic drive through the Ngorongoro Conservation Area, with stunning landscapes and panoramic views along the way. Arrive in the Serengeti in time for an afternoon game drive, spotting lions, elephants, giraffes, zebras, and wildebeest across the endless savannah. Capture breathtaking wildlife and landscapes while your expert guide shares insights about the ecosystem and animal behavior. In the evening, check into your tented camp in Central Serengeti for dinner and overnight stay, preparing for a full day of safari exploration tomorrow.

Central Serengeti Early Morning Game Drive & Transfer to Karatu

Central Serengeti Early Morning Game Drive & Transfer to Karatu

Start the day with an early morning game drive in the Central Serengeti, when wildlife is most active and predators are often on the move. Spot lions, cheetahs, elephants, giraffes, and herds of wildebeest while the savannah awakens at sunrise. After the morning safari, enjoy breakfast at your lodge or camp and then depart for Karatu, a scenic town near the Ngorongoro Conservation Area. Admire the highland landscapes en route and, depending on time, stop at viewpoints overlooking the crater. Arrive in Karatu in the afternoon, check into your lodge, and enjoy dinner and overnight stay in preparation for a full-day Ngorongoro adventure tomorrow.

Ngorongoro Crater Game Drive & Return to Arusha

Ngorongoro Crater Game Drive & Return to Arusha

After an early breakfast at your Karatu lodge, depart for a full-day game drive in the Ngorongoro Crater, one of Africa’s most famous wildlife destinations. Explore the caldera’s dense wildlife population, including lions, elephants, zebras, hippos, and the elusive black rhino. Enjoy a picnic lunch amid breathtaking scenery. In the afternoon, ascend from the crater and begin the journey back to Arusha, where your driver can drop you at your hotel or Kilimanjaro International Airport for an additional cost. Conclude your 5-Day Northern Tanzania Safari Adventure with memories of unforgettable wildlife encounters, stunning landscapes, and cultural experiences.
